  80. /**
  81.  * <i>LatentStateSpecification</i> holds the fields necessary to specify a complete Latent State. It includes
  82.  * the Latent State Type, the Latent State Label, and the Latent State Quantification metric.
  83.  *
  84.  *  <br><br>
  85.  *  <ul>
  86.  *      <li><b>Module </b> = <a href = "https://github.com/lakshmiDRIP/DROP/tree/master/ProductCore.md">Product Core Module</a></li>
  87.  *      <li><b>Library</b> = <a href = "https://github.com/lakshmiDRIP/DROP/tree/master/FixedIncomeAnalyticsLibrary.md">Fixed Income Analytics</a></li>
  88.  *      <li><b>Project</b> = <a href = "https://github.com/lakshmiDRIP/DROP/tree/master/src/main/java/org/drip/state/README.md">Latent State Inference and Creation Utilities</a></li>
  89.  *      <li><b>Package</b> = <a href = "https://github.com/lakshmiDRIP/DROP/tree/master/src/main/java/org/drip/state/representation/README.md">Latent State Merge Sub-stretch</a></li>
  90.  *  </ul>
  91.  * <br><br>
  92.  *
  93.  * @author Lakshmi Krishnamurthy
  94.  */

  95. public class LatentStateSpecification {
  96.     private java.lang.String _strLatentState = "";
  97.     private org.drip.state.identifier.LatentStateLabel _label = null;
  98.     private java.lang.String _strLatentStateQuantificationMetric = "";

  99.     /**
  100.      * LatentStateSpecification constructor
  101.      *
  102.      * @param strLatentState The Latent State
  103.      * @param strLatentStateQuantificationMetric The Latent State Quantification Metric
  104.      * @param label The Specific Latent State Label
  105.      *
  106.      * @throws java.lang.Exception Thrown if the Inputs are invalid
  107.      */

  108.     public LatentStateSpecification (
  109.         final java.lang.String strLatentState,
  110.         final java.lang.String strLatentStateQuantificationMetric,
  111.         final org.drip.state.identifier.LatentStateLabel label)
  112.         throws java.lang.Exception
  113.     {
  114.         if (null == (_strLatentState = strLatentState) || _strLatentState.isEmpty() || null ==
  115.             (_strLatentStateQuantificationMetric = strLatentStateQuantificationMetric) ||
  116.                 _strLatentStateQuantificationMetric.isEmpty() || null == (_label = label))
  117.             throw new java.lang.Exception ("LatentStateSpecification ctr: Invalid Inputs");
  118.     }

  119.     /**
  120.      * Retrieve the Latent State
  121.      *
  122.      * @return The Latent State
  123.      */

  124.     public java.lang.String latentState()
  125.     {
  126.         return _strLatentState;
  127.     }

  128.     /**
  129.      * Retrieve the Latent State Label
  130.      *
  131.      * @return The Latent State Label
  132.      */

  133.     public org.drip.state.identifier.LatentStateLabel label()
  134.     {
  135.         return _label;
  136.     }

  137.     /**
  138.      * Retrieve the Latent State Quantification Metric
  139.      *
  140.      * @return The Latent State Quantification Metric
  141.      */

  142.     public java.lang.String latentStateQuantificationMetric()
  143.     {
  144.         return _strLatentStateQuantificationMetric;
  145.     }

  146.     /**
  147.      * Does the Specified Latent State Specification Instance match the current one?
  148.      *
  149.      * @param lssOther The "Other" Latent State Specification Instance
  150.      *
  151.      * @return TRUE - Matches the Specified Latent State Specification Instance
  152.      */

  153.     public boolean match (
  154.         final LatentStateSpecification lssOther)
  155.     {
  156.         return null == lssOther ? false : _strLatentState.equalsIgnoreCase (lssOther.latentState()) &&
  157.             _strLatentStateQuantificationMetric.equalsIgnoreCase (lssOther.latentStateQuantificationMetric())
  158.                 && _label.match (lssOther.label());
  159.     }

  160.     /**
  161.      * Display the Latent State Details
  162.      *
  163.      * @param strComment The Comment Prefix
  164.      */

  165.     public void displayString (
  166.         final java.lang.String strComment)
  167.     {
  168.         System.out.println ("\t[LatentStateSpecification]: " + _strLatentState + " | " +
  169.             _strLatentStateQuantificationMetric + " | " + _label.fullyQualifiedName());
  170.     }
  171. }
